Effects of Gingerol on Melanogenesis of B16 Melanoma Cells / 医药导报

ABSTRACT
Objective To study the effects of the gingerol on the melanogenesis in melanoma B16 cells. Methods Melanoma cells were cultured with gingerol at 12. 5, 25. 0, 50. 0, 100. 0, 200. 0 μmol · L-1 and positive control drug hydroquinone,respectively,using Dulbecco's modified eagle's medium(DMEM) as the blank control group. The cell proliferation was measured by methyl thiazolyltet tetrazolium ( MTT) colorimetric assay. The tyrosinase activity and melanin content were measured by colorimetry assay. Results Gingerol at different concentrations had inhibitory effect on B16 cell proliferation compared with the blank control group ( P < 0. 05 or P < 0. 01), the inhibition rate being more than 48% at the dosage of 200. 0 μmol·L-1 . Tyrosinase activity was inhibited significantly compared with blank control group(P<0. 05 or P<0. 01),the inhibition rate being up to 50% at the dosage of 200 μmol·L-1 . Melanin content was also decreased at all levels of gingerol compared with blank control group(P<0. 05 or P<0. 01),but not in a dose-dependent manner. The inhibition rate of melanin content reached the plateau at gingerol levels greater than 25. 0 μmol · L-1 . Conclusion Gingerol can inhibit the cell proliferation,tyrosinase activity and decrease melanin synthesis in certain range of concentrations.
